Mozilla/Firefox Issue
 
We're designing a new board using vBulletin 4.1.4. Everything is going well and it works great in IE and Google Chrome but in Mozilla Firefox the Navbar shows up at the bottom and the footer display right under the top navbar but none of the main page content displays.

I'm using an older version of Mozilla/Firefox (3.6.18) so the latest version may display properly but unfortunately as we all know there are plenty of folks that don't upgrade their browsers.

Any ideas on something that may be causing this problem?

Thank you in advance for any assistance.
